ホームページ >ウェブフロントエンド >jsチュートリアル >HTMLページコード内の画像アドレスを取得するjs実装コード

HTMLページコード内の画像アドレスを取得するjs実装コード

亚连
亚连オリジナル
2018-06-01 11:23:141347ブラウズ

この記事では、HTMLコードで画像アドレスを取得するためのjsの実装コードを主に紹介しますので、必要な方は参考にしてください

最初の方法: jsを規則に従って実装します

/** 
 * 获取html代码中图片地址 
 * @param htmlstr 
 * @returns {Array} 
 */ 
function getimgsrc(htmlstr) { 
  var reg = /<img.+?src=(&#39;|")?([^&#39;"]+)(&#39;|")?(?:\s+|>)/gim; 
  var arr = []; 
  while (tem = reg.exec(htmlstr)) { 
    arr.push(tem[2]); 
  } 
  return arr; 
}

2番目の方法: jqueryを実装します

 var img = $(this).find("img").attr("src");//这个是获得相对路径 prospertu
        //alert($(this).find("img").prop("src"));这个是获得完整路径 包括http://

js 取得した画像のsrcは相対パスです

jsはsrc取得時、または画像パスがmall/kmenus/001.pngの場合は同時にドメイン名のパスも取得します。または http://localhost/mall/kmenus/001.png を取得しますが、通常は相対パスを取得するだけで十分です。この記録を作ってください。

rreee

以上が皆さんのためにまとめたもので、今後皆さんのお役に立てれば幸いです。

関連記事:

vueを使って簡単な本を模倣したカルーセルチャートのサンプルコードを書く

vue-cliで作成したプロジェクトのローダー問題を解決する

setTimeout時間を0に設定する 詳細な分析

以上がHTMLページコード内の画像アドレスを取得するjs実装コードの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。